网站大量收购独家精品文档,联系QQ:2885784924

卷积码编译码开题报告.docx

  1. 1、本文档共22页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

毕业设计(论文)

PAGE

1-

毕业设计(论文)报告

题目:

卷积码编译码开题报告

学号:

姓名:

学院:

专业:

指导教师:

起止日期:

卷积码编译码开题报告

摘要:本文针对卷积码编译码技术进行研究,首先介绍了卷积码的基本原理和编译码方法,然后分析了当前卷积码编译码技术的研究现状,最后针对卷积码编译码过程中存在的问题,提出了一种改进的编译码算法,并通过仿真实验验证了该算法的有效性。本文的研究成果对于提高卷积码编译码性能、降低通信系统误码率具有重要意义。

随着通信技术的快速发展,通信系统对数据传输速率和可靠性的要求越来越高。卷积码作为一种重要的线性分组码,因其良好的纠错性能和较低的编译码复杂度而被广泛应用于通信系统中。然而,传统的卷积码编译码方法在处理高码率、长码长时,存在编译码复杂度较高、误码率较高等问题。为了解决这些问题,本文对卷积码编译码技术进行了深入研究。

第一章卷积码基本原理

1.1卷积码的定义及特性

卷积码是一种重要的线性分组码,广泛应用于现代通信系统中。它通过将信息序列与生成多项式进行模二运算,生成冗余信息,以提高数据的传输可靠性。在卷积码的定义中,信息序列通常由k个比特组成,而码字则由n个比特构成,其中n大于k。每个码字都是通过对信息序列和生成多项式进行线性运算得到的。生成多项式通常由m个比特组成,其中m是码字的约束长度。

卷积码的特性主要体现在其卷积结构上,这种结构使得卷积码在解码过程中能够适应不同的错误模式,从而实现较好的纠错性能。卷积码的纠错能力通常由码字的约束长度和自由度决定。约束长度是指码字中所有可能的序列中,满足特定约束条件的序列数量,而自由度则是指码字中可用于传输信息比特的数量。一般来说,约束长度越长,自由度越低,码字的纠错能力越强。例如,一个约束长度为7、自由度为1的卷积码,其纠错能力可以达到纠正一个比特错误或者两个比特的错误。

在实际应用中,卷积码的纠错性能通常用误码率(BER)来衡量。误码率是指在通信过程中,由于信道噪声等原因导致接收到的码字与发送的码字不一致的概率。根据理论和实验结果,卷积码的误码率与码字的约束长度、自由度以及编码和解码算法等因素密切相关。例如,在码率为1/2的卷积码中,使用最大似然(ML)解码算法,当约束长度为7时,理论上可以达到的最小误码率大约为10^-3。这一性能指标对于现代通信系统来说具有重要的实际意义。

卷积码的另一个特性是其编译码算法的复杂性。在传统的卷积码编译码方法中,通常采用维特比(Viterbi)算法进行解码,该算法需要存储大量的状态和路径信息,对于码长较长或码率较高的卷积码来说,编译码算法的复杂度会急剧增加。为了解决这个问题,研究人员提出了多种高效的编译码算法,如迭代解码算法、联合编译码算法等。这些算法通过减少存储空间和降低计算复杂度,实现了在保证纠错性能的同时,降低编译码算法的复杂度。以迭代解码算法为例,其在码长为1023、码率为1/2的卷积码中,可以将编译码复杂度降低到传统维特比算法的1/8左右。这一改进对于提高通信系统的实时性和可靠性具有重要意义。

1.2卷积码的编码原理

(1)卷积码的编码过程涉及信息序列和生成多项式的线性组合。信息序列是待传输的数据,通常由k个比特组成。生成多项式是由m个比特构成的,用于生成冗余信息。编码器根据信息序列和生成多项式进行模二运算,生成码字。例如,在码率为1/2的卷积码中,每两个信息比特生成一个码字。

(2)在编码过程中,编码器通常采用线性移位寄存器(LSR)来实现。信息比特依次输入LSR,同时与生成多项式进行模二加法运算。LSR的输出形成码字,其中包含了信息比特和冗余比特。这种编码方式允许在传输过程中对信息进行纠错。例如,在生成多项式为x^3+1的情况下,编码器会生成一个3比特的码字。

(3)编码后的码字可以通过不同的传输信道进行传输。在接收端,解码器根据码字和生成多项式进行解码,以恢复原始信息序列。解码过程通常包括两个步骤:首先检测和纠正错误,然后恢复信息比特。在实际应用中,常用的解码算法包括维特比算法、伯纳德算法等。这些算法能够有效地处理信道噪声和干扰,提高通信系统的可靠性。例如,在误码率为10^-4的信道中,使用维特比算法可以纠正大约1%的错误率。

1.3卷积码的解码原理

(1)卷积码的解码原理是基于最大似然(MaximumLikelihood,ML)准则,其目的是从接收到的码字中恢复出原始信息序列。解码过程主要分为两个阶段:错误检测和错误纠正。在第一个阶段,解码器通过比较接收到的码字和所有可能的码字,找出与接收码字最相似的码字,即最大似然码字。这个阶段通常使用维特比算法(ViterbiAlgorithm)来实现,该算法能够有效地处

文档评论(0)

153****9248 + 关注
实名认证
内容提供者

专注于中小学教案的个性定制:修改,审批等。本人已有6年教写相关工作经验,具有基本的教案定制,修改,审批等能力。可承接教案,读后感,检讨书,工作计划书等多方面的工作。欢迎大家咨询^

1亿VIP精品文档

相关文档